A brief summary of Sawston in Cambridgeshire
Sawston is a large village located in Cambridgeshire, England, approximately seven miles south of Cambridge, with a population of 7,271. Nestled along the River Cam, this vibrant community is an important area for planning applications, offering a mix of residential and commercial development opportunities. The settlement has a population of approximately 7,271 (2021 estimate). It sits within the South Cambridgeshire district.
Property prices in Sawston show an average sale price of £496,489, based on 50 recent transactions recorded by HM Land Registry.
There were no crimes reported in the immediate area during the most recent reporting period. This makes Sawston a particularly low-crime area.
Sawston has 3 conservation areas within its boundaries: Sawston, Whittlesford, Pampisford. Planning applications within or near these conservation areas are subject to additional scrutiny to preserve the architectural and historic character of the area. Homeowners and developers should be aware that permitted development rights may be restricted.
Ecology & Nature Designations
The area around Sawston includes 2 Sites of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I): Dernford Fen SSSI, Sawston Hall Meadows SSSI.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.

Planning Activity in Sawston
In the last 24 months, 81 planning applications were submitted near Sawston. Of these, 83% were approved, with an average decision time of 45 days.
This is broadly in line with the national average of approximately 87%. Sawston maintains a standard approach to planning decisions.
The average decision time of 45 days is within the government's 8-week statutory target for minor applications, indicating an efficient planning department.
The most common application types near Sawston were full planning applications (20), tree works (11), discharge of conditions (11). Full planning applications account for 25%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.
In terms of development scale, 1 large-scale (major) development, 66 smaller schemes were submitted.
